Up your walks — Once you have mastered the basics, and your cat is happy … teresa barbatoWebRemember: Play for a few short sessions every day. Allow your cat to catch and grab the toy at the end of each game. Provide a variety of toys. At the end of each session tidy away toys with string, or anything that might present a danger to your cat. Never force your cat to play or be trained.
